1. Prodigy | Ride1UP | Premium Class 3 Electric Bike

This eclectic mountain bike easily ranks as a top choice because it has tons of desirable features for half the competitors’ price. With the Prodigy Ride 1Up electric mountain bike, you get to enjoy a pedal-assisted speed of 28 MPH and a throttle-powered speed of 20 MPH.

Aside from impressive speeds, the Prodigy comes with an advanced Brose control system, 9s-speed transmission, a 500W motor, and Tektro Orion hydro disc brakes that easily take your rides to new levels. All of these features are wrapped into a sporty and sleek 50 lb. bike that can easily go anywhere.

Don’t forget about comfort. The Prodigy is also designed for peak performance thanks to a Selle Royal Viento saddle and thin tires that are light and easily maneuvered. However, this also means that the bike is more suitable for all-around off-roading experiences instead of rough trails.

Pros:

  • Under 50 pounds total
  • Pedal-assisted 28 MPH/Throttle-powered 20 MPH
  • Refined Brose control system
  • 9-Speed transmission
  • 500W motor
  • Tekro Orion hydro disk brakes
  • Comfortable and lightweight

Cons:

  • Thinner tires than other models
  • Not great for rougher terrains

2. RadRover 5 Electric Fat Bike

There’s a reason why the RadRover 5 ranks on our list of the top 4 amazing electric mountain bikes under $4,000 – people love it, and that’s why it won the Best Electric Fat Bike of 2021. But what’s to enjoy about this electric mountain bike? Let’s look at the details.

One of the best things about the RadRover 5 is that it comes with incredible 4” wheels that can take on all types of terrains, from sand to snow, which means you don’t have to limit your adventures. Paired with a 7-speed transmission and 80Nm, you have all the torque you need to conquer uphill climbs, too.

It has a comfortable riding position with specialty features like lights, a handy kickstand, and fenders for your convenience. With trustable Tektro Aries Mechanical Disc brakes, you can feel confident while you ride.

Speaking of protection, the tires on the RadRover 5 are designed with a unique Kenda K-shield that fends off potential punctures from thorns, grass, and other sharp materials.

Pros:

  • 750W of power-on-demand
  • Tektro Aries Mechanical Disc brakes
  • Brake light
  • Protective fenders
  • Kenda K-shield tire lining
  • 4” tires

Cons:

  • Only a 7-speed transmission

3. Pace 500 Step Through E-Bike | Aventon Bikes

The Pace 500 has gotten thousands upon thousands of 5-star reviews. It’s even been noted as the ‘Biggest bang for your buck’ by Forbes. If that’s not enough to sway you into buying this impressive electric mountain bike, maybe these details will.

Just because this is a cost-effective bike, you still get all of the features you’d want in an electric mountain bike, such as a powerful 750W motor and five levels of peda-assist up to 20 MPH. Pretty incredible, right? Essentially, with this bike, nothing is off-limits. Feel free to take the road less traveled.

A few other standout features every rider will enjoy is a blacklist LCD screen to maneuver levels and see how far you’ve traveled, an upright frame with a comfortable saddle, and an equipped throttle.

Pros:

  • 750W motor
  • Upright frame
  • Comfortable saddle
  • 5-speed transmission
  • Pedal-assist up to 20 MPH

Cons:

  • No suspension in front or back

4. Powerfly 4 | Trek Bikes

While this might be more expensive than the aforementioned electric mountain bikes, it’s well worth the price. The Powerfly 4 comes with enough power from the 500W motor to get you anywhere you need to go.

Not only that, but this electric mountain bike under $4,000 comes with specialty parts to ensure a long-lasting bike and smooth right. In every Powerfly 4 you will find smooth-shifting Shimano drivetrain and a use-friendly Removable Integrated Battery system that sits sleekly inside the bike’s frame for a streamlined, classy, and professional appearance.

This electric mountain bike is designed to take you to boundaries you have never even dreamed of. It even comes with Walk Assistant and intelligent eMTB that delivers the exact amount of power needed for the terrain you’re riding on. You just don’t see that type of smart technology in ‘cheaper’ models!

Pros:

  • Removable battery
  • Streamlined look
  • 500W motor
  • Pedal-assist up to 20 MPH
  • Walk Assistant and intelligent eMTB

Cons:

  • Comes with cheaper fork and brakes

Things to Consider

Here are a few key things to consider when finding the electric mountain bike under $4,000 that’s right for you.

Type of Tires

On this list, we see a bike with a thin tire and one with fat tires, plus two with regular sizes. Each comes with its own realm of pros and cons. For example, thinner may be more lightweight but won’t be able to handle rugged terrains.

Battery Voltage

You want to make sure you’re buying a battery with voltage you need. That way, you don’t end up without a charge on the side of the mountain. That said, pay attention to the battery voltage and how long the battery can sustain this charge.

Motor

A strong motor is best for those planning to go on excursions in different terrains and scales. A powerful motor will be able to handle uphill and downhill with ease whether you’re on sandy, snowy, or rocky terrain.

MPH

Consider the overall MPH of the pedal-assist. This is critical. If you want your bike to lend you a helping hand with lots of speed, then you need to find a bike that can take on the heat.

Features

Want extra features for your convenience? Everyone has a personal preference when it comes to features they want or need, such as a backlit LED or an intelligent eMTB. Pay attention to what each bike has to offer to find the one that’s right for you.

Price

Last but not least, consider the price. Yes, it’s clear that you’re here to stick to a budget of under $4,000, but that doesn’t mean you want to get as close to $4,000 as possible. There are a lot of options on this list that are under the $2,000 range, which means almost every budget can find what they’re looking for.
